Publicitate
Mac-urile sunt grozave, cu UI-ul lor îngrijit și un back-end Unix. Uneori ai senzația că poți face aproape orice cu ei. Până într-o zi încerci să faci ceva simplu și îți dai seama de ceea ce ai nevoie, pur și simplu nu este disponibil nativ. În acest caz, vorbesc despre wget.
În cazul în care nu știți, wget este un instrument incredibil de util pentru linia de comandă pentru a descărca pagini web întregi, inclusiv media și adâncimea de legătură pe care doriți. Este destul de puternic și sofisticat și este foarte util atunci când încercați să faceți copii de rezervă - mai ales că poate fi lucrat în scripturi. Nu este nevoie de un guru Unix pentru a pune mâna pe el și a-l folosi. Poate fi al tău în câțiva pași, care sunt suficient de jalnici pentru a justifica scrierea.
Obțineți binarul Wget
Aceasta este o metodă de înșelăciune care ar putea să nu fie pe vecie și poate să nu funcționeze pentru toată lumea, dar este rapidă. Un suflet foarte amabil numit Quentin Stafford-Fraser a făcut un
binar de wget pentru Mac OS X Leopard. Descărcați fișierul zip și dezarhivați-l. Copiați fișierul wget în /usr/local/bin (și urmați instrucțiunile README, de asemenea, pentru alte fișiere).Dacă acest lucru nu a funcționat pentru dvs. din anumite motive, citiți mai departe.
Obțineți un compilator C / C ++ pentru Mac
Dacă nu aveți deja un compilator C / C ++ pentru Mac, va trebui să aveți unul. Cea mai ușoară modalitate de a le obține este să instalați Xcode din instrumentele Mac Developer, care este disponibil gratuit pe discul de instalare al sistemului de operare sau pentru Lion prin intermediul Mac App Store.
Dacă niciuna dintre acestea nu este o opțiune, instalați pachetul corespunzător conform instrucțiunilor de la hpc.sourceforge.net.
Obțineți XZ Utiles pentru Mac
Pachetul wget vine ca un fișier comprimat xz și este trist, dar este adevărat, că acest format nu este acceptat de utilitatea MacOS Unzip. Deci, du-te o copie de Utilitare XZ pentru Mac pentru a putea dezarhiva pachetul wget atunci când îl primiți.
Obțineți pachetul Wget folosind HTTP sau FTP
Mergeți spre pagina wget și descărcați pachetul wget prin HTTP sau FTP sau un site cu oglinzi care vi se potrivește. Descărcați cea mai recentă versiune pe care o puteți găsi.
Decuplați și instalați Wget
Deschideți aplicația Terminal (Aplicații> Utilitare> Terminal) și navigați către oriunde a fost descărcat pachetul.
cd ~ / Descărcări
Decuplați fișierul folosind XZ Utiles și tar (înlocuiți numele fișierului cu orice versiune wget pe care ați descărcat-o):
xz -d wget-1.13.tar.xz. gudron-xf wget-1.13.tar
Intrați în noul director wget și executați aceste comenzi în ordine:
cd wget-1.13. ./configure. face. sudo make install
Câteva idei pentru utilizarea Wget
Wget poate fi utilizat în orice caz în care puteți utiliza DownThemAll pentru a obține imagini, muzică sau video în vrac de pe un site web. Poate fi, de asemenea, utilizat pentru a face backup pentru site-uri web întregi și poate oglindește-le pentru conservare.
Dacă încă nu sunteți sigur pentru ce ați putea folosi Wget, luați în considerare utilizarea Wget pentru a face o copie de rezervă a directoarelor foto online sau pentru a prelua fișiere MP3 din dosarele deschise online. Oriunde știți de unde există un folder plin de media sau o pagină care leagă sau afișează media poate fi descărcat cu o singură comandă folosind Wget. Deși este posibil să folosiți Wget pentru divertisment pentru care probabil că ar fi trebuit să plătiți, există o mulțime de utilizări onorabile.
De exemplu, dacă lucrați pentru o companie mică care nu este atât de grozavă cu backup-urile lor, poate puteți utiliza Wget într-un script pentru a face backup pentru site-ul companiei dvs. Când va veni ziua inevitabilă și serverul de lucru se va prăbuși, veți salva ziua prin faptul că puteți obține o copie de rezervă recentă. Același lucru este valabil și pentru site-urile web ale comunității dvs. preferate sau orice altceva condus de amatori: clubul tău de picior, grupul de dramă local sau orice altceva sunteți implicat.
Wget este deosebit de bun dacă toată lumea a uitat parola sau dacă hackerii și-au schimbat parola site-ului. Wget poate apuca toate lucrurile importante pentru tine și poți începe proaspăt.
Folosind Wget
Iată un exemplu rapid de comandă Wget pentru crearea unei oglinzi a tuturor HTML-urilor și a suporturilor de pe o pagină.
wget -m //www.makeuseof.com/
Este simplu și eficient, deși sincer nu recomand să încercați acest exemplu special acasă!
Scripturi și Descărcări Cool
Dacă sunteți în automatizare și descărcare, aici mai puteți citi:
- Cum să faci o copie de rezervă automată de la distanță a blogului tău WordPress Cum se face o copie de siguranță automatizată de pe blogul dvs. WordpressÎn acest weekend, site-ul meu web a fost hacked pentru prima dată. M-am gândit că este un eveniment care trebuia să se întâmple în cele din urmă, dar mă simțeam un pic șocat. Am avut noroc că ... Citeste mai mult
- Cum să executați lucrări Cron în stil Linux pe Windows Cum să executați lucrări Cron în stil Linux pe Windows Citeste mai mult
- Cum să utilizați feeduri RSS pentru a descărca automat torrents Cum să utilizați feeduri RSS pentru a descărca automat torrents Citeste mai mult
- Cum să găsiți directoare de site-uri web neprotejate și să primiți fișiere „interesante” Cum să găsiți directoare de site-uri web neprotejate și să primiți fișiere „interesante” Citeste mai mult
Pentru ce folosești wget? Anunță-ne!
Credit imagine: Descărcați pictograma sticlă albastră prin Shutterstock, Om în câmp de grâu care se bucură prin Shutterstock
Ange este un absolvent de Studii și Jurnalism pe Internet, care iubește să lucreze online, să scrie și la social media.